CONSTRUCTION FEATURES

PKA-N HEATER

+

• Stainless steel AISI 430 combustion chamber ,with high exchange surface (with higher volume inrespect to the thermal load). Thanks to its particularshape, it assures low thermal loads and an uniformheat distribution.

• Reverse flame combustion chamber , with threepass combustion circuit, completely welded, toassure a long operating life.

• High efficiency stainless steel AISI 304 heatexchanger constituted by a conic section tube heatexchanger with aerodynamic profile.

• Patented tube heat exchanger(Patent n° MI94U00260 dd. 08th April 1994).

• Exchanger tubes and plates are T.I.G. welded.

• One front and four rear inspection panels on theheat exchanger made in stainless steel AISI 430.

• Insulation of the inspection panels made inceramic fibre .

• Sight glass with combustion chamber pressuretap.

• Insulation panel for the burner plate made inmineral fibre.

B) ) Frame and casing

• Supporting frame made in aluminium.

• Double sandwich panels insulated with glass woolto limit the heat losses and improving the efficiencymade of:

- Insulated panels on the exchanger section withthickness 25 mm, complete with gaskets, made of- external panel: pre-coated galvanised sheetiron, protected with plastic film, 1mm thickness- insulating material made of glass wool 32 kgm³- internal panel: galvanised sheet iron, 0,6 mmthickness, fixed with rivets on the external panel;

- Insulated sandwich panels on the fan sectionwith thickness 25 mm, complete with gaskets,made of:- external panel: pre-coated galvanised sheetiron, protected with plastic film, 1mm thickness.- insulating material made of glass wool 32 kg/m³covered on the external side with glass tissue.Fixed to the external panel by means ofgalvanised sheet iron bars fixed with rivets.

• Air inlet protected by means of a galvanised steelgrille 1,5 mm thickness. Standard location on theright, possibility to change easily to the left.

• All heaters are equipped with lifting lugs.

C) Fan section

• One or more centrifugal fans according to theheater capacity with low rotation speed, to grantlow noise.

• Double aspiration fans, statically anddynamically balanced, operated by motors,transmissions with belt and pulley (apart frommodels PK-N032 and PK-N035 at directtransmission)

• Fan motor protection degree IP54.

• Fan and motor supporting base in aluminium.

• For motors from 5,5 kW onwards, starting methodstar delta.

D) Safety devices

• Fan and limit (manual reset) thermostats .

• External control board in epoxy powder paintedsteel, protection degree IP44, in conformity with theexisting norms (EN60335-1). It is fitted with:

- Main switch with door lock.

- Summer/OFF/winter switch.

- Fuse, contactor and thermal relay for each fanmotor.

- Auxiliary relay.

- Power supply signal lamp.

- Thermal relay tripped lamp.

CAPACITYThe working principle of the PK-N Heater is verysimple.

The ambient air (7) to be heated is sucked by thecentrifugal fan (5) through the aspiration grille (1),and it is heated (8) passing on the combustionchamber (3) and on the heat exchanger (4).

The hot air (9) is then thrown in the ambient, directlyby an outlet plenum, or through a duct system.

The heater has the following safety devices(10):fan thermostat and safety thermostat.

All main electrical components are fitted in theelectrical board (6) .

Upon request, the heater can be supplied withburner (2).

AVAILABLE STATICPRESSURES

The standard available static pressures are:

-version 00A (only for PKA-N), installation withplenum, where there is no need of high air pressure.This allows the use of motor with lower speed,consequently assuring lower running costs, thanksto a saving in the consumption, and higher comfortthanks to the low level noise;

-version 10A, with medium available static pressurevalues, for installation with duct systems when noparticular pressure is needed;-version 20A , with high available static pressure, forinstallations with articulated duct systems or withhigh air speed.

AVAILABLE STATIC PRESSURE

WORKING FIELD

Each heater has a wide working field, that goes fromthe minimum power, with a maximum certifiedefficiency from 93.1% to 94.6%, to the maximumpower with a minimum efficiency from 87.5% to90.8%.

The use of an oversized heater with regard to theambient heat request, allows a higher plantefficiency. As you can see from the followingdiagram, should the ambient heat request be of 190kW, using a PKA190N heater, the efficiency is of90.5%; whereas using a PKA 250N, the efficiencygoes up to 92.5%.

CERTIFIED QUALITY

The PK-N heaters are built in conformity with theEuropean Norms PR EN 1020.

They are approved by GASTEC with CE markn. 0063AQ0300 according to the Gas Directive 90/396/CEE.

They comply with Machines Directive 89/392/EEC,Low Voltage Directive 72/23/EEC, Electro MagneticCompliance EMC 89/336/CEE.

Each heater has been approved to operate witha working field between a minimum andmaximum value .

On request, the PK-N heaters can be supplied withplenum for the air distribution and air filter for theambient purification.

Distribution plenum

The plenum is supplied with bifilar louvers suitablefor the use in industrial and commercialenvironments.The accurate design and manufacturing allow toobtain a plenum with louvers assuring high airdelivery with strong air throw and reduced pressurelosses.

The standard plenum is manufactured with the airthrow in three directions: two short sides and onelong side.

On specific request, it can be supplied with the airthrow on two long sides and one short side.

Discharge

The heater is a B23 type, that is an appliancewithout draught switch and with burner fan beforethe heat exchanger.

The heater can be connected both to flue ducts andchimneys.

MAINTENANCE

All the maintenance operations are particularlysimple and fast and guarantee the heater'sefficiency.

To reach the heat exchanger, it is sufficient to takeoff the front inspection panel.

The fan cleaning can be made with a compressorand with a vacuum cleaner.

The filters can be regenerated through thecleaning with compressed air.

It should be noted that in the installations withduct systems, the filter positioned inside can beremoved for servicing and maintenance withoutany need to disconnect the ducts.

Air filter

The air filter has been designed and manufacturedin modacrilic fibre, fire-proof class 1, can be used incontinuous service up to a maximum temperature of80°C and has an average efficiency equal to 85%(according to the EN 779 Norm) corresponding toclass G3.

The air filters, in the standard versions, have beendimensioned to make the aspiration only from oneside.In case of particular requirements, for examplehorizontal or downflow installations, contact ApenGroup to obtain the right sizing.
